Description

Delosperma monanthemum (also called 'Monanthemum Vygie', among many other common names) is a perennial succulent plant native to South Africa. It has small, round, fleshy leaves and produces daisy-like flowers that are typically yellow or white. It is found in rocky areas and on sandy soils.

Uses & Benefits

Delosperma monanthemum is a popular ornamental plant, used in rock gardens, as a groundcover, or in containers. It is drought tolerant and requires little maintenance.

Flower, Seeds and Seedlings

Delosperma monanthemum has yellow flowers with a dark center. The seeds are small and black. The seedlings are small and have a single pair of leaves.

Cultivation and Propagation

Delosperma monanthemum is a hardy, drought-resistant, evergreen succulent groundcover that is native to South Africa. It can be propagated from seed or cuttings. To propagate from seed, sow in well-draining soil and keep moist. To propagate from cuttings, take a stem cutting and allow it to dry for a few days before planting in well-draining soil. Keep the soil moist until the cutting has rooted.

Where to Find Delosperma monanthemum

Delosperma monanthemum can be found in the Eastern Cape of South Africa.
